A Domino’s Pizza franchisee, North County Pizza Inc., has filed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y, bringing renewed attention to the health and operating model of Domino’s large franchise network. This event highlights critical questions regarding how Domino’s manages growth, cost pressures, and franchisee support, especially given mixed stock performance. Investors are advised to watch for updates on refranchising, store closures, and changes to fees that could impact the system’s overall profitability and investment case.
